		<description><![CDATA[On the patriot act extensions, it&#039;s a bit misleading to praise the Tea Party for splitting with the rest of the Republicans : of the 111 &quot;Tea Party endorsed&quot;, 96 voted for the extension, 12 voted against, and 3 didn&#039;t vote. This is essentially indistinguishable from the other Republicans, at 114/14/2.]]></description>
